...能的程度。量子计算机即使带来一亿倍的破解速度提升,那也不过是抵消了比特币256位私钥长度中的27位而已(2^27=1.3亿)。就算外星人出现,连续发生了数次一亿倍破解速度提升(每次抵消27位私钥长度),比特币也只要简单地把私钥长度升级到512位即可。15位密码不过比5位密码多输入几位,耗时几秒...
知识:私钥,比特币,长度,一亿
...和32的基础上增加多币种,例如你一个HD的钱包可以同时管理主网和测试网的比特币。 BIP0043提出使用第一个强化子索引作为特殊的标识符表示树状结构的“purpose”。基于BIP0043,HD钱包应该使用且只用第一层级的树的分支,而且有索引号码去识别结构并且有命名空间来定义剩余的树的目的地。举个例子...
知识:钱包,比特币,区块链
...基于整数分解问题设计的加密体制,这里的整数是很大的,比如是2^256长的比特串,此种加密体制没有涉及到数字签名。ElGamal_DSA,是基于离散对数问题设计的加密体制。EC_DSA,是基于有限运算的运算对数问题设计的加密体制。Lattice_DSA,是基于最短象限的寻找问题设计的加密体制。这四种加密体制出现...
知识:私钥,公钥,椭圆曲线数字签名,密码学
...基于整数分解问题设计的加密体制,这里的整数是很大的,比如是2^256长的比特串,此种加密体制没有涉及到数字签名。ElGamal_DSA,是基于离散对数问题设计的加密体制。EC_DSA,是基于有限运算的运算对数问题设计的加密体制。Lattice_DSA,是基于最短象限的寻找问题设计的加密体制。这四种加密体制出现...
知识:密码学
... decrypt 解密 crytography 密码 confidentiality 机密性、加密等级 Bit、byte:比特(Bit)与字节(byte)的关系是8个Bit = 1byte 编码:将数据(文本、音频、视频)映射为比特序列的过程。 密钥:固定长度的字符串。通过密钥及加解密算法,对给定的数据进行加密和解密。 对称加密:在加密和解密的过程...
知识:密钥,字节,非对称
韭菜币圈区块链?今天区块链数字货币加密算法公式除了哈希算法以外,比特币中还存在一种为交易加密的非对称加密算法(椭圆曲线加密算法)。非对称加密算法指的就是存在一对数学相关的密钥,使用其中一个密钥进行加密的数据信息,只有使用另一个密钥才能对该信息进行解密。这对密钥中,对外...
知识:私钥,公钥,比特币,区块链
...个是公开密钥,另一个是私有密钥。顾名思义,公钥可以任意对外发布;而私钥必须由用户自行严格秘密保管,绝不透过任何途径向任何人提供,也不会透露给要通信的另一方。非对称加密算法实现机密信息交换的基本过程是:甲方生成一对密钥并将公钥公开,需要向甲方发送信息的其他角色(乙方)使...
知识:私钥,公钥,椭圆曲线数字签名,导出私钥
...个是公开密钥,另一个是私有密钥。顾名思义,公钥可以任意对外发布;而私钥必须由用户自行严格秘密保管,绝不透过任何途径向任何人提供,也不会透露给要通信的另一方。非对称加密算法实现机密信息交换的基本过程是:甲方生成一对密钥并将公钥公开,需要向甲方发送信息的其他角色(乙方)使...
知识:算法,数字签名,非对称加密,安全性,私钥
...些情况下,数字签名本身可能包括了加密的过程,但并非总是这样。例如,比特币区块链使用PKC和数字签名,而并不像大多数人所认为的,这个过程中并没有进行加密。从技术上讲,比特币又部署了所谓的椭圆曲线数字签名算法(ECDSA)来验证交易。数字签名的工作原理在加密货币的背景下,数字签名...
知识:私钥,公钥,加密货币,数字签名
...已知加密密钥推导出解密密钥在计算上是不可行的。签名是用非对称算法的私钥签名,然后用私钥对应的公钥来验证签名,的主要作用是确定发送方的身份。除了签名,非对称加密算法还有一个用处是加密和解密,加密则是用公钥来对信息加密,然后用对应的私钥进行解密,主要作用是向接收方传递加...
知识:随机数
对于比特币交易来说,支付的钱不是给个人的,而且支付给交易另外一方的私钥,这就是交易匿名性的根本原因,因为没有人知道,这些私钥背后的主人到底是谁?所以比特币交易的第一件就是要注册生成属于自己的公钥和私钥。现在网上的比特币交易所开户,基本都是会让你生成一个比特币钱包(wall...
知识:公钥,支付,比特币钱包,私钥
<h3></h3>比特币系统或区块链技术并不是单一的技术,即使在密码学层面,也包含了非对称密码算法、哈希函数、安全多方计算等多种技术。<h4>(1)非对称密码算法</h4>非对称密码加密过程示意图传统的对称密码算法在秘密信息传输时双方需要共享同一个会话密钥。秘密信息发送方使用这个会话密钥对信...
知识:私钥,公钥,区块,链上
比特币钱包就是一对密钥对(公钥和私钥对),几种流行的一般都使用ECC或者RSA算法,如果是ECC密钥长度是168位,如果是RSA密钥长度是2048位,一般密钥使用BASE58编码存储,也就是,为了区分各种加密货币,每种货币的密钥对都有一个识别的头部,大约5个字符,剩下的30多个字符是密钥,一般来讲使用短...
知识:私钥,公钥,货币,比特币
...数、块大小、块头部、交易个数、交易,阅读本文建议先阅读下。 比特币交易的整个流程涉及到secp256k1加密,比特币地址的生成,数字签名校验,比特币的脚本系统,本文将详细介绍比特币地址的生成、数字签名过程以及脚本系统。至于secp256k1加密,它实际上是上述几个内容的基石要讲清楚需...
知识:Block
...哈希算法包括MD2、MD4、MD5和SHA-1,在区块链的第一个也是目前最经典的应用比特币中,采用了SHA-256的哈希算法。哈希表是根据设定的哈希函数H(key)和处理冲突方法将一组关键字映射到一个有限的地址区间上,并以关键字在地址区间中的镜像记录在表中的存储位置、这种表被称为哈希表或散列,所得的...
知识:区块,私钥,公钥,区块链